Android devices are widely used around the world, offering a customizable experience through the installation of custom ROMs. While this flexibility benefits users, it introduces significant challenges for digital forensic investigators. Understanding these challenges is crucial for effective evidence collection and analysis.
What Are Custom ROMs?
Custom ROMs are modified versions of the Android operating system developed by third-party developers or communities. They often provide enhanced features, improved performance, or additional privacy options. Popular examples include LineageOS, Pixel Experience, and Resurrection Remix.
Forensic Challenges Posed by Custom ROMs
1. Variability of Firmware
Custom ROMs come in many versions, each with different file structures and system modifications. This variability complicates the process of standardizing forensic procedures and tools, making it harder to extract consistent evidence across devices.
2. Data Encryption and Security Features
Many custom ROMs include enhanced security features or custom encryption methods that can hinder data recovery. Investigators may face difficulties bypassing encryption or accessing protected data without proper keys or vulnerabilities.
3. Altered System Files and Logs
Modifications in custom ROMs can overwrite or hide system logs, app data, and other artifacts. This can obscure evidence and require specialized techniques to uncover hidden or deleted information.
Strategies for Overcoming Forensic Challenges
- Developing a comprehensive understanding of different custom ROM architectures.
- Utilizing specialized forensic tools capable of handling diverse file systems and encryption methods.
- Collaborating with developers and communities to identify potential vulnerabilities or data remnants.
- Maintaining updated procedures that account for the latest ROM modifications and security features.
By staying informed and adaptable, forensic professionals can improve their chances of successfully retrieving and analyzing data from Android devices running custom ROMs, despite the inherent challenges.
